Somebody had to be first to introduce a color-laser-based AIO for $1,000 or less. That somebody is Canon, with the Canon Color imageClass MF8170c ($1,000 street). Built around a four-pass color laser engine with a scanner mounted on top, a 50-page ADF, and a front panel that also lets it work as a standalone fax machine and color copier, the MF8170c is of obvious interest to anyone who's looking for a color laser AIO at an affordable price.

- Price as Tested: $1,000.00 Street
- Type: All-In-One
- Connection Type: USB, Ethernet
- Maximum Standard Paper Size: Legal
- Rated speed at Default Resolution (Mono): 16 ppm
- Rated Speed at Default Resolution (Color): 4 ppm
- Scanner Type: Flatbed with ADF (Standard or Optional)
- Scanner Optical Resolution: 1200 pixels per inch
- Maximum Scan Area: 8.5" x 14"
- Standalone Copier and Fax: Copier, Fax
